## Runbook: FieldNote offline mode

When FieldNote (our field-survey app) loses connectivity, it queues survey submissions in a local store and syncs once the uplink returns. Mostly this just works, but reviewers should check two things: the queue flush doesn't reorder entries, and conflict resolution always prefers the surveyor's local copy. If sync stalls past an hour, bounce the sync worker — it's idempotent, promise.

The worker reads the following configuration values at startup.

settings of fafog-haduf:
ZORIX_PIN=4648
ZORIX_METRICS_HOST=metrics.zorix.paliqsys.corp
ZORIX_LOG_LEVEL=info
ZORIX_TENANT=druix

## Deploy Step 4 — Order Cutoff Rule

Crumbfort enforces a hard cutoff for next-day bakery orders. Set `CUTOFF_HOUR=16` and `CUTOFF_TZ` to the shop's local zone; orders placed after that roll to the following business day. If the Halloway Street shop complains about missing morning orders, check these two values first — nine times out of ten someone fat-fingered the hour. After the cutoff vars, the cutoff service needs its scheduler credential to authenticate against the order queue; put it on the line directly below.

sealed setting: ARCHIVE_KEY3=8d0

**Action item (stale-cache postmortem, Quillbarn outage):** Support folks, quick heads-up from the retro. The stale-cache bug meant customers saw old plan tiers for up to six hours, so expect a trickle of billing confusion tickets through next week. Short version for replies: caches now expire after five minutes and we added a manual purge button. Marnie is owning the fix rollout. Full timeline, canned responses, and the refund policy for affected accounts live on the internal wiki page.

wiki page, tahaf-tajog: https://jira.ordindyn.corp/pipeline